Van Dijk Warns Liverpool against Complacency Despite Premier League Lead
Liverpool captain Virgil van Dijk has issued a stern warning to his teammates, urging them to remain focused despite their commanding position at the top of the Premier league. The Reds secured a hard-fought 2-0 victory over Brentford on January 19, 2025, thanks to two late goals from substitute Darwin nuñez, extending their lead to six points over second-placed Arsenal.
The win at Anfield saw Liverpool reach 50 points, further solidifying their title aspirations. Though, Van Dijk emphasized that the journey is far from over. “Every victory is a grate result. Especially when the team around us is so strong,” he said.The Dutch defender highlighted the challenges posed by Brentford,who tested Liverpool’s resolve with their structured play and counter-attacking threat. “They have a very clear structure. Even if you try to penetrate a deep defense, but if you lose the ball sometimes, you may be countered,” Van Dijk explained.
Despite the victory, Van Dijk acknowledged the difficulties Liverpool faced. “They created many risky moments. And they do that against a lot of teams in the league,but we handled it well and could have scored more,” he added.
Van Dijk’s message was clear: complacency is not an option. “It was no walk in the park,every game there were a lot of teams doing very well. They want to play their best against us.If no one is ready to tackle the bumpy road,this season will definitely be like I said,” he warned.
Liverpool’s recent form has been extraordinary, but the captain’s words serve as a reminder of the relentless nature of the Premier League. With Arsenal and other contenders breathing down their necks, consistency will be key.Key Points from Liverpool’s Victory
